worik Posted January 27, 2022 Posted January 27, 2022 21 minutes ago, Laura said: My quests have too much stuff going on to do it that way. Actors need to be in their base position, all doors need to be in their base state and actors may need to be resurrected and stuff like that. Technically, you could add a quest stage early at quest startup that checks and sets everything in place for the quest a quest stage at the end the release, clean up and remove everything that should be gone, when the quest is done. or you add a management quest to perform these tasks in the background . Both techniques are used in other story-telling mods like yours. It might add a few bugs here and there, but once you have them in place, the overall stability and usability might profit. ? Though it would be a considerable amount of work to add that piece of player's comfort. 1
